The threat of oil exploration and the extension of the United States and Canada's fishery limits to 200 miles in the 1970s led to fisheries and jurisdiction disputes over these productive fishing grounds. These prompted the publication of this massive review of the natural science of the bank. Geology, oceanography, ecology and fisheries in great depth. .

Richard Haven Backus (1922-2012) was a prominent biological oceanographer at the Woods Hole Oceanographic Institution. His college years were interrupted by WWII during which he became a B-24 navigator (1st Lieutenant) in the 8th Army Air Force based in England during the intense air campaign over Germany. After an emergency landing in Switzerland, Dick escaped internment to fly again in the Pacific/Japan theater in the Military Air Transport Command. While completing his doctorate accepted a position in 1952 at the Woods Hole Oceanographic Institution (WHOI) where he worked his entire career. An outstanding achievement during his career was the organization and editing of this multidisciplinary book "Georges Bank" published in 1987 by MIT Press. The depth and clarity of the book's 57 articles and 8 nontechnical introductions will make it useful for anyone involved in oceanographic or ocean policy studies. Sections cover all aspects of this huge marine ecosystem - geology, weather and climate, physical oceanography, chemistry, phytoplankton, primary production, zoology and secondary production, the fisheries, and conflicting uses. Georges Bank is the first major project of the Coastal Research Center of Woods Hole Oceanographic Institution. The book Includes 176 six-color maps, 54 four-color illustrations - 392 charts, graphs, and drawings. This massive book has 593 pages that measure 340mm X 385mm and it weighs over 5 kilograms. The book is bound in light blue cloth, with white lettering and a blind embossed codfish and it is in fine condition. There is a large folded Bathymetric Chart of Georges Bank and Vicinity in a pouch inside the back cover.
